What to know about ZIP 49655

ZIP code 49655 covers Le Roy, MI in Osceola County with a population of about 3,415.

At a glance, the area shows median age of 43.7 versus a U.S. median of about 38.9.

It sits in telephone area code 231; U.S. House district MI-2; the TRAVERSE CITY - CADILLAC media market.

Income and economy in Le Roy, MI

Median household income in ZIP 49655 is about $67,375 — about 10% below the U.S. median ($75,149).

On socioeconomic markers, US5 shows a poverty rate of 12.6%; unemployment rate near 9.8%; 16.4% of adults with a bachelor’s degree or higher (about 17.4 points below the national share (33.7%)).

Labor and commute patterns include leading industry context around Manufacturing, Healthcare, and Education; about 7.0% of workers reporting work-from-home (about 8.2 points below the U.S. share (15.2%)); a mean commute of about 180.0 minutes (U.S. average near 26.8).

Housing and affordability in ZIP 49655

Median home value is about $171,800 — about 51% below the U.S. median home value ($348,079).

Housing tenure and rents show median gross rent around $479 (about 59% below the U.S. median rent ($1,163)), and owner-occupancy near 95.5% (about 30.0 points above the national owner-occupancy rate (65.4%)).
